The Nationwide Labor Relations Board has dominated that Google’s refusal to cut price with YouTube Music’s unionized contract staff is unlawful.
Each Google and its sub-contractor Cognizant denied any wrongdoing after the contractors joined the Alphabet Employees Union. The argument cropped up over Google’s mandate to return to work for hourly professionals. Many of those contractors have been employed remotely throughout the pandemic and argued that extra bills for childcare and transportation meant they might not return with out a vital pay increase.
In the meantime, Google argues that it contracts Cognizant to cope with the employees and so it has no position within the collective bargaining course of. How companies decide who’re joint employers of contract and franchise staff has been murky for the reason that Obama administration. The NLRB used a rule adopted throughout President Trump’s administration that claims companies should train direct management over staff to be required to cut price with them.
A panel of three members of the NLRB agreed that Google straight supervises the YouTube music contract staff, who carry out data-related duties.
They’re Google’s first line of protection in opposition to discovering errors in its charts algorithm. “In any respect materials instances, Respondents Cognizant and Google have co-determined the important phrases and situations of employment of staff employed on the E. Parmer Lane facility and have been joint employers,” the board writes in its choice.
In a press release made to Bloomberg, a Google spokesperson confirmed the corporate plans to enchantment the ruling in federal courtroom. “As we’ve mentioned earlier than, we’ve got no objection to those Cognizant staff electing to kind a union. We merely consider it’s solely acceptable for Cognizant, as their employer, to interact in collective bargaining.”
In the meantime, YouTube Music staff Katie-Marie Marschner says any appeals are Alphabet’s try and keep away from collective bargaining to “pad the pockets of shareholders and executives.” Google was ordered to stop and desist from refusing to acknowledge and negotiate with these union staff below federal labor regulation.
